Best way to travel between

Trivandrum Airport, Thiruvananthapuram, Kerala, India
Bahrain International Airport, Muharraq, Muharraq Governorate, Bahrain
Travel Modes
3769.92 km
13h 29mins
407.15 kgs
6562.5 km
97h 35mins
840.0 kgs
Tranport Distance Time(hrs) Cost(local) Cost(usd)
Flight 3769.92 km 13h 29mins 159 BHD 423.0
Drive 6562.5 km 97h 35mins 264 BHD 700.0
Take Flight from TRV to HOF
Time: 8h 5mins Cost: 128 BHD; $ 306.0 - 374.0 USD CO2 Emission: 380.35 kgs
Take Car from Hofuf to Al Hufof
Time: 16mins Cost: 9 BHD; $ 21.6 - 26.4 USD CO2 Emission: 2.16 kgs
Take Train from Al Hufof to Dammam
Time: 1h 20mins Cost: 3 BHD; $ 6.3 - 7.7 USD CO2 Emission: 7.55 kgs
Take Car from Dammam to Dammam
Time: 8mins Cost: 4 BHD; $ 9.9 - 12.1 USD CO2 Emission: 0.89 kgs
Take Bus from Dammam to Manama - Lulu Centre
Time: 1h 32mins Cost: 6 BHD; $ 14.4 - 17.6 USD CO2 Emission: 2.26 kgs
Take Car from Manama - Lulu Centre to Al Muḩarraq
Time: 7mins Cost: 11 BHD; $ 26.1 - 31.9 USD CO2 Emission: 0.83 kgs
Source: Rome2rio

Mode of travel comparision chart

The best and cheapest way to get from Trivandrum Airport, Thiruvananthapuram, Kerala, India and Bahrain International Airport, Muharraq, Muharraq Governorate, Bahrain is to travel by air, which will cost about 159 BHD or 380.70 USD.